Insights into Cybersecurity Essentials for Cork Chamber Members 

Cork Chamber recently hosted an insightful 'Industry Insights' event focusing on the critical issue of cybersecurity.  Experts Damien McCann, Chief Commercial Officer at Viatel Technology Group, and Ed Heneghan, cybersecurity consultant and founder of Henocon, hosted a practical and interactive conversation on the growing threat of cybercrime. 

The speakers stressed the stark reality that businesses today fall into two categories: those that have been breached and those that are unaware or unwilling to admit that they have been compromised.  With cyber threats becoming increasingly sophisticated, prevention is crucial, but so is preparing for the inevitable.  Businesses must develop robust plans to maintain operational capacity in the event of an attack. 

The event underscored that cybersecurity is no longer solely the responsibility of IT departments. It is a company-wide concern that demands the active engagement of senior management.  Incoming legislation, such as NIS2, will hold leadership directly accountable for cybersecurity failures, making it imperative for them to oversee and actively participate in security initiatives. 

"Cybercrime is a lucrative industry," the speakers cautioned, highlighting the sophisticated tactics employed by attackers to identify and exploit vulnerabilities. "They employ analysts to assess targets’ value and weaknesses. Protecting your data is paramount. Proactivity is key in cybersecurity. An ounce of prevention is worth several thousand pounds worth of a cure" 

Multi-factor authentication was recommended as a fundamental security measure for all businesses. However, technology alone is not enough.  Employee awareness and training are vital components of a strong security posture. "A well-informed employee acts as a human firewall, an additional layer of defence," the speakers emphasised.  "Individuals handling sensitive information, such as payments and credentials, must be vigilant and aware of potential threats."
